
This is a hot reservation in Vancouver and it was buzzing the night we were there. The chef as well as other “quality control” people roam constantly from the dining room to the open kitchen. Our waiter was particularly fun and was eager to suggest other places we should go during our stay.

I think if I hadn’t been so stuffed from lunch it might have seemed better, but as it was I left a lot on my plate. The pine mushrooms were a nightly special and as I love something new I tried them. As verified the next night, they’re not my favorite – kind of a resin taste that wasn’t appealing- but if they’re your thing, these were fresh and served with wonderful arugula. I found both pastas to be a tad too al dente for me and the pesto didn’t have the punch I’ve grown to love in it. Portions are generous and they’ve got a nice selection of Grappa for after dinner. Overall a pleasant experience.
